The writeup on their website was very misleading. This "Country Lodge" is at the corner of a busy intersection. The room was shabby, the desk chair seat had collapsed, and it was dirty. There was an extra charge for internet. I couldn't wait to leave.

I should have kept driving. My room was filthy, the paint was filthy and the carped was stained. There was low water pressure and it took forever to get hot water. Many of the rooms appeared to be occupited by construction company employees and they did plenty of partying. The free wireless internet did not reach my room.
